New York City-based Saluda Grade, an alternative investment firm with a concentration in asset-based finance, announced Thursday that Patrick Lo is joining the company as its co-chief investment officer.
Lo has more than 20 years of experience in alternative credit and asset-based investing. He will work with Timothy Carr in the newly created co-CIO role to oversee Saluda Grade‘s investment process and lead its expansion into a larger set of financing capabilities beyond its current focus in residential and commercial real estate.
